The site is segmented for various audiences. A brief description of each subdivision follows.
  • Underground for Kids This section is directed toward elementary school students. Sniffy the Sniffasaurus directs young visitors to the section, while Maurice the Mole and Ernesto the Earthworm join the fun along the way. The Underground for Kids contains facts about natural gas. Pages describe how it is distributed and instruct elementary students on the safe use of natural gas. Other information includes vocabulary games and activities, science facts, biographical sketches of individuals who have made important discoveries and innovations relating to natural gas, conservation of natural resources, and information about careers in natural gas utilities.
  • Deep EarthThis section is especially for middle school and junior high grades. It contains more information on various topics related to natural gas, its production and distribution. The section uses the planet Earth as a background to its navigation system. Subdivisions are: Safety, Science, History, Language, Conservation and Careers.
  • The Zone This area is for the older student or young adult who needs even more detailed information about generation and distribution of natural gas, natural gas safety and the people, places and patents that have made history. Subdivisions are: Safety Zone, Comm Center, Tech Zone, The Archive, Envirowatch and Career Zone.
  • Natural SourceThis section is for adults. It teaches natural gas safety and is organized in sections emphasizing safety around the home and safety around the workplace.
  • Teachers' LoungeThe Teachers Lounge is an educators’ resource area that contains resources for educational materials and a list of web sites to visit. It also offers lesson plans and experiments about natural gas and energy in general. These areas are updated periodically.
  • Contractor InfoContractor Info contains important safety information including calling before digging, pipeline safety, using a spotter and avoiding power lines.
